Output dd26abded56d84bd69efc070676586ae69916862953408b6c089babd688894b9:0

value
320700
script pubkey
OP_0 OP_PUSHBYTES_20 daa370a245c9e446a7ff8ad1eaaec5a9d1d6aa0c
address
bc1qm23hpgj9e8jydfll3tg74tk948gad2sv5s9kln
transaction
dd26abded56d84bd69efc070676586ae69916862953408b6c089babd688894b9
spent
true